Transaction 578922739a53a7df0631cf5abfe5a64eef24fcf100e538a709b2c0603adfd801
1 Input
2 Outputs
- 578922739a53a7df0631cf5abfe5a64eef24fcf100e538a709b2c0603adfd801:0
- 578922739a53a7df0631cf5abfe5a64eef24fcf100e538a709b2c0603adfd801:1
value 119036
address 1E82nh5bB2Qfw1UAwPzSCr1QuNV1JMPhtj
value 24165375
address 1sS91hSKHnZgxeb6vLHEzPVJvb4D17Dsv